Hello everybody,
my name is Stephan and I live in Germany near Munich.
The C1P was my first computer. I got it back in 1980 when I was 16 years old, and with it I learned programming.
In 2013 I fetched it out of the basement, cleaned it and turned it back on. Here are a few photos on Google +:
https://plus.google.com/photos/10475176 ... 5746087009
As you can see it in one photo, I was able to attach it to my flatscreen TV.
I tried to add the RS232 interface to the board, as it is described in "The First Book of Ohio Scientific". Unfortunately I couldn't get it to work at that time and gave up, but now that I found this forum I might give it another try.
Other things I'm interested in are the JavaScript C1P simulator at pcsjs.org and the cc65 C compiler for the 6502.
